Okk To prevent battery drain on a Samsung device, you can try several methods:Optimize settings: Adjust screen brightness, turn off unnecessary features like Bluetooth, GPS, or NFC when not in use.Limit background processes: Close apps running in the background that you're not using.Update apps and software: Ensure your device's operating system and apps are up to date to benefit from performance and battery optimizations.Use power-saving modes: Enable power-saving modes provided by Samsung, which can restrict background processes and optimize performance.Monitor battery usage: Check which apps are consuming the most battery power and consider uninstalling or optimizing them.Manage sync settings: Reduce the frequency of syncing for apps like email, social media, and cloud services.Keep your device cool: High temperatures can drain the battery faster, so avoid exposing your device to extreme heat.Use a dark theme: On devices with OLED screens, using a dark theme can help save battery power by reducing the energy needed to display black pixels.Consider a battery replacement: If your battery is old or not holding a charge well, consider replacing it to improve battery life.
